Web3 May 2024 · The inception of anagen phase is presented by the onset of the mitotic activity in the secondary epithelial germ located between the club hair and dermal papilla in telogen hair follicle [5, 16]. The anagen is the active growth phase in which the follicle enlarges and takes the original shape and the hair fiber is produced.

Web11 May 2024 · Fast-cycling P-cadherin + progenitors are found in the secondary hair germ, the compartment sandwiched between the bulge and dermal papilla 88. Cells of the hair germ are transcriptionally more active than bulge cells and begin to proliferate in late telogen, a few days before bulge cells 3. The mesenchymal compartment is comprised of …
